New Zealand might be a small country, but it packs a lot in – and if clients haven’t already got the Bay of Islands on their list, it’s time to add it. Located about three hours’ drive north of Auckland, this 144-island archipelago is a hotspot for penguins, dolphins, whales and other wildlife, with subtropical rainforest, scenic coastal trails and charming seaside towns among the lures. HOP OVER TO TASMANIA
From craggy coastlines studded with seals and penguins to the Alpine peaks of Cradle Mountain National Park, Tasmania’s natural beauty is well-documented – but it’s not only about the wildlife. This diverse island is home to a growing culinary scene, with locally produced gin, whisky and wine meeting fresh seafood, truffles and cheese, and a string of gourmet restaurants on hand to celebrate its foodie heritage. savour A POLYNESIAN WELCOME IN SAMOA
If beaches plucked from paradise, rainforests filled with wildlife and waters the colour of cobalt sound like your clients’ thing, suggest a trip to Samoa, where authentic Polynesian cultures meet rustic, one-off stays. The biggest of its nine islands are Savai’i, home to plunging waterfalls and forested volcanoes, and Upolu, where deserted beaches sit side by side with colourful, sleepy villages.
